Here are some other recommendations for getting the longest life from the internal battery.

Fully charge the battery before using it.
Avoid full discharge of the battery if possible. Li-Ion batteries are
maintenance-free, and the battery will last longest when operating
between 30–80% charged.
Do not use the product while charging the battery.
Do not charge the battery in exceedingly hot (greater than 90°F/32°C) or
exceedingly cold (less than 32°F/0°C) temperatures.
For best product longevity, do not store at exceedingly hot (greater than
90°F/32°C) or exceedingly cold (less than 32°F/0°C) temperatures.
For best product longevity, store with a 50% battery charge.
If you leave the battery level low and do not charge it for 6 months, it may
permanently lose capacity.
If the battery fails to charge, contact ION Audio at ionaudio.com.
Bring the unit to a recycling center or dispose of in accordance with local
ordinances.
